Output 96e0d503d5a29284ffbd24cd183d15c774eece25860f1386e1b05ec8623ac4f4:6

value
84323029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df098b900862d714e61fd8c6ca26f90a829dfff8 OP_EQUAL
address
MUEUMRCyEs6u6pwFkxHUBikavS4T1HmrYT
transaction
96e0d503d5a29284ffbd24cd183d15c774eece25860f1386e1b05ec8623ac4f4
spent
true